Output 93643e5a3b37d4f97261feaa771a210fd952d817fa8da73cc4a00affe3a586a3:1

value
1958000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3fc84739681266e4e47c36cf0ffaeda3fa58859 OP_EQUAL
address
3M1u1EdFMSDSHDW1QTzYVM1CtahGXE13PF
transaction
93643e5a3b37d4f97261feaa771a210fd952d817fa8da73cc4a00affe3a586a3
confirmations
442746
spent
true